POTSDAM, NY – Certified Physician Assistant Luke Gillis (PA-C) has joined the Emergency Services Department at Canton-Potsdam Hospital (CPH) and Massena Hospital (MH).

Mr. Gillis is certified by the National Commission on Certification of Physician Assistants, and earned his Master of Science in Physician Assistance Studies degree from Clarkson University, Potsdam. He spent two of his clinical rotations at the hospitals he will now be working in – CPH and MH.

“During rotations at Canton-Potsdam and Massena hospital, the Emergency Department and hospitals as a whole were very team-oriented and supportive. I noticed this culture led to a positive experience for both our patients and the staff, and it is something I look forward to joining,” Mr. Gillis said.

Raised in rural North Carolina, he noted the North Country provides a similar community feel as to where he grew up.

“Staying in the local area after graduating from Physician Assistant school has given me a sense of familiarity and stability while starting a new career,” Mr. Gillis commented. “Constantly moving to different duty stations while I was in the United States Air Force made it difficult to establish myself in an area for an extended amount of time. Staying local gives me that comfort while growing as a provider.”

As a Physician Assistant, Mr. Gillis conducts physical examinations, diagnoses illnesses, prescribes medications, orders and interprets diagnostic tests, and performs suturing and castings.
